How do I fix this webpage is not secure

If you’re seeing a message on your webpage that says “Not Secure”, then there could be an issue with the security of the website. This could be because the website doesn’t have an SSL certificate, which is needed if you want to have a secure connection between your web page and the user’s browser.

An SSL certificate is a digital certificate issued by a Certificate Authority (CA), which ensures that all data sent between the server and browser remains private and secure. It also authenticates the identity of the website, meaning users can trust that they are accessing the right site. Without an SSL certificate, a website is considered “not secure” and any information sent or received on the page will not be encrypted.

If you need to fix this issue, you will need to purchase an SSL certificate from a trusted Certificate Authority. Once you have done this, you will need to install it on your web server and configure it correctly. You can find more detailed instructions for setting up an SSL certificate online.

Once you have installed and configured the SSL certificate, you should test it to make sure everything is working correctly. You can use a tool like Qualys SSL Labs or DigiCert Certificate Inspector to do this. If all tests pass, then your webpage should now be secure and no longer display a “Not Secure” warning message.

It’s important to remember that having an SSL certificate is only one part of keeping your website secure. You should also take steps to ensure that other components of your website are secure, such as ensuring that all software is up-to-date and patching any vulnerabilities in your code or configuration settings. Additionally, it’s important to keep an eye out for any new security threats and stay informed about best-practices for keeping your website safe and secure.

How do I fix HTTPS certificate errors in Chrome

If you’re seeing HTTPS certificate errors in Chrome, it means there’s something wrong with the website’s security certificate. This can happen for a variety of reasons, such as an expired certificate, a misconfigured server, or a certificate that doesn’t cover the domain name. Fortunately, there are some things you can do to fix the issue.

The first step is to check if the website is using a valid SSL/TLS certificate. To do this, open Chrome and navigate to the website in question. In the address bar, look for a lock icon and click it. This will open a window with more information about the site’s security certificate. Look for the “Valid From” and “Valid Until” dates to make sure the certificate is still valid. If it isn’t, contact the website owner to get an updated certificate.

If the HTTPS certificate is valid, then you can try clearing your browser cache and cookies. Clearing your browser’s cache and cookies can help resolve many issues with loading websites, including HTTPS certificate errors. To do this in Chrome, click on the three-dot menu in the top-right corner of the window and select “More Tools > Clear Browsing Data…” Select “Cookies and other site data” and “Cached images and files” and click Clear Data.

You may also need to update your browser to ensure that it has all of the latest security patches installed. To do this in Chrome, open the three-dot menu again and select “Help > About Google Chrome”. This will show you what version of Chrome you have installed and check if there are any available updates. If there are any available updates, click Install Update to install them.

Finally, if none of these solutions work, you can try resetting your browser settings. Resetting your browser settings will restore all of its settings back to their default values and may help resolve any lingering issues with loading websites or HTTPS certificate errors. To reset Chrome, open the three-dot menu again and select “Settings > Advanced > Reset settings”. Click Reset settings to confirm your changes.

By following these steps, you should be able to resolve any HTTPS certificate errors you’re seeing in Chrome.
